Output 89a6d23df8560b121ed2a590db9c197a1e4b78afb69d35ccb8fc1f8ef373a1a2:0

value
14128705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1afda22e532451f68081b57c0b5adfb4318fd573 OP_EQUAL
address
349jLJC6Ps7kqyPWYpjNeax8YgxQR3d57u
transaction
89a6d23df8560b121ed2a590db9c197a1e4b78afb69d35ccb8fc1f8ef373a1a2
spent
true